The Black Stump Hotel

Dogs welcome

Updated 26 Aug 2026

No photos yet
Be the first to share a photo of this spot.

The Black Stump Hotel is a dog-friendly pub in Merriwagga, with dogs welcome throughout the venue.

Dog rules

Dogs are welcome throughout the hotel except in the dining room.

Please keep dogs leashed, calm, and under control for the comfort of all patrons.

At a glance

Dog friendly throughoutAdmin verified
Outdoor spaceConfirmed with venue staff
Shade availableConfirmed with venue staff
Sheltered seatingConfirmed with venue staff
